Le Jardinier Vallier," a captivating oil on canvas painting by the renowned Post-Impressionist artist Paul Cézanne, dates back to approximately 1904-1906. This masterpiece is currently housed in the esteemed Foundation E.G. Buhrle Collection in Zurich, Switzerland. Cézanne, a pioneer of modern art, is celebrated for his innovative approach to composition and color, which is beautifully embodied in this work. In "Le Jardinier Vallier," the artist invites us into a serene and intimate garden setting, where a gardener, Vallier, is depicted in deep concentration as he tends to his plants. The painting's title, which translates to "The Gardener Vallier," suggests a focus on the subject's occupation and the connection between the man and his environment. The lush greenery, vibrant flowers, and rich textures of the garden are rendered with remarkable detail and depth, while Vallier is portrayed with a sense of quiet intensity. The artist's use of color and brushwork creates a sense of depth and dimension, inviting the viewer to explore the scene further. The painting's composition, with Vallier situated off-center and the garden stretching out behind him, adds to the sense of tranquility and contemplation. "Le Jardinier Vallier" is a testament to Cézanne's mastery of oil painting and his ability to capture the essence of a moment in time. The painting's enduring appeal lies in its exploration of the relationship between the human experience and the natural world, making it a must-see for any art enthusiast or collector. This painting is an excellent example of Cézanne's Post-Impressionist style, which influenced a generation of modern artists and continues to inspire contemporary art today. The Foundation E.G. Buhrle Collection is privileged to own such a significant work, and it serves as a reminder of Cézanne's lasting impact on the art world.
